7 Reading skill: Distinguishing facts from opinions My parents have been married for 25years. (Fact) Relationships with human beings are messy and unpredictable. (Opinion) Class stars at 7:30 a.m. (fact) My classes are difficult. (opinion)

10 Reading #2. In Defense of Advertising Main idea: Advertising provides us with quite a few benefits. Supporting details 1)Giving us information 2)Supporting the arts 3)Helping support sports 4)Public service announcements inform the public 5)Helping to make the world more colorful

13 Grammar: Compound sentence Simple sentence : Subject + Verb ( independent clause) e.g. Usha drives to work every day. subject + verb Compound sentence contains two independent clauses joined by coordinating conjunction such as ‘and’, ‘but’, ‘so’, and ‘or’. e.g. The ad was very funny, and it gave us helpful information. e.g. We enjoyed the movie, but it had a very sad ending. e.g. Ali isn’t feeling well, so he isn’t coming to class today. e.g. You can take the train to Madrid, or you can fly.
